24-Hour Blood Pressure Monitoring - Part One

Many people have what's called "white coat hypertension." Their blood pressure goes up when they go to the doctor's office only to return to a normal level when they go home. To help differentiate those with this phenomenon from those with chronic hypertension, Alegent Nephrology has launched 24-hour blood pressure monitoring. There are so many benefits to this procedure. The machine checks your blood pressure at home for a 24-hour period. The process is easy, but I wanted to show you how it's done so you know how it works. This is part one of a two part series.
